Types of Bank Accounts and Withdrawal Methods

" "

Understanding the types of bank accounts you have and the various methods of withdrawal is vital for maintaining control over your finances. There are primarily two types of bank accounts: savings and checking.

" "

Savings Accounts

" "

For withdrawals from a savings account, you typically need to visit your bank in person. The process involves:

" " " "Presenting your identification and account details. " "Writing a withdrawal slip which should be filled out with all the necessary information. " "Presenting the slip to the teller for processing. " " " "

Checking Accounts

" "

Checking accounts offer more convenience for daily transactions. You can withdraw funds using several methods:

" "

ATM Withdrawals

" "

For withdrawals using an ATM, you'll need:

" " " "Your debit card (ATM card). " "Your PIN for authentication. " "

Insert your card, enter your PIN, and select the withdrawal option from the ATM interface.

" "

Point of Sale (POS) Transactions

" "

When making purchases with a debit card at stores, the POS system automatically deducts funds from your checking account.

" "

Bank Tellers

" "

Visiting a physical branch to withdraw funds can be a secure option for larger amounts. The process involves:

" " " "Presenting your identification and account details. " "Writing a check which should be filled out accurately with all the necessary information. " "Cashing the check directly at the bank. " " " "

It's also worth noting that some banks provide online banking services, allowing you to check your balance and initiate withdrawals from the comfort of your home.

Ensuring Account Security

" "

To protect your financial assets and maintain a secure banking relationship, consider the following best practices:

" " " "Keep your PIN confidential and update it regularly. " "Monitor your bank statements and transaction history regularly to detect any unauthorized activity. " "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) for added security. " "Use reputable financial institutions that prioritize cybersecurity measures. " " " "
